View of 30th eruption of ash of Mount Vesuvius
View of 30th eruption of ash of Mount Vesuvius, 9 August 1779, by Francesco Catozzo, engraved by Gennaro Bartolo in 1804. Veduta della trentesima eruzione de cenere delli 9 Agosto 1779 (View of 30th eruption of ash of the 9 August 1779). Engraving
